Inside the solar panel
At the very heart of any solar panel, you'll find its engine: the photovoltaic (PV) cell. This is where the real magic happens. Think of each cell as a miniature power plant, working tirelessly to turn sunlight directly into electricity through what's called the photovoltaic effect.

24V Solar Flexible Shaft Water Pump Inverter
DC controller can show power, voltage, current and speed values. 24V solar powered pump can be used for deep well, small fountain, pond or water tank. The water pump stops working automatically when there is no water in the well, and it will automatically restart working 30 minutes later.

Is there a high-power solar water pump inverter?
A solar pump inverter converts the DC electricity from solar panels into AC power to drive water pumps. It also controls pump operation based on sunlight intensity, enhancing energy efficiency and ensuring consistent water output — especially vital for agriculture and remote drinking water systems.
